SINGAPORE: CGS-CIMB launched on Tuesday (March 30), a digital investment service targeted at millennials, offering eight asset classes across 30 exchanges in 25 markets. 

ProsperUs aims to attract 10,000 investors in the next 12 months. With a minimum investment of S$1,000, new customers who sign up between April to June 2021 stand a chance to receive between S$280 and S$880 worth of free tokens to offset their trading fees.
